Acquiring a Police Clearance Certificate: A Step-by-Step Process
A Police Clearance Certificate (PCC) is often required for various purposes, such as immigration. The process of obtaining a PCC can seem lengthy, but by following these steps, you can navigate the procedure.
- First, contact your local department to inquire about the specific requirements and procedures for obtaining a PCC in your jurisdiction.
- , Subsequently, gather all the necessary documents, which may include a valid form of identification, proof of residency, and copyright-sized photographs.
- Submit your completed application form along with the required documents to the designated authority.
- Settle the applicable charge for processing the PCC request.
- Wait the processing time, which can vary depending on the workload of the police department. You will be contacted when your PCC is ready for retrieval.
It's important to note that the process may differ slightly depending on the country you are applying from or residing in. Be sure to consult the relevant agencies for specific guidelines and instructions.

Obtaining A National Police Clearance Certificate
A National Police Clearance Certificate (NPCC), also referred to as a police record check or certificate of good conduct, is an essential document that attests your criminal history. Provided by the national police force of a country, it commonly outlines any convictions or pending charges against an individual. NPCCs are often required for international travel, employment opportunities, educational pursuits, and numerous other purposes that necessitate verifying an individual's background.
- To receive an NPCC, you usually need to provide a formal application to the relevant authorities.
- Depending your specific circumstances, you may have to furnish supporting documents like identification.
- The processing time for an NPCC can differ depending on the country and the workload of the issuing agency.
It's important to remember that an NPCC is a legal document and should be treated with caution. Safeguard your certificate from loss or unauthorized access.
Obtaining Police Clearance Requirements and Applications
A police clearance certificate is commonly required when seeking for jobs, visas, or other official requests. To obtain a police clearance certificate, you will typically need to present an application to your local police department. The specific requirements can vary depending on your region, so it's important to contact your local police department for further information.
Typically, the application process involves providing personal data, such as your full name, date of birth, and address. You may also need to submit supporting materials, such as a copyright-sized photograph and a valid form of proof. Once your application is received, it will be processed by the police department.
The review time can differ depending on the workload of the department.
After your application has been authorized, you will receive a police clearance certificate, which may be in either electronic format. Remember to keep your police clearance certificate in a safe place as it may be required for future submissions.
